Haiti - Social : UNASUR gives $1 million for the PNCS

Renewing with its support to the National Program of School Canteens (PNCS), Ambassador Rodolfo Mattarollo, Special Representative of the Technical Secretariat of the Union of South American Nations (UNASUR) in Haiti, announced a cash donation of a amount of U.S. $1 million, coming from the commitment of the UNASUR to Haiti. This aid will be channeled towards preferably primary schools located in the departments of Grande Anse and Nippes.

This announcement was made as part of a signing ceremony of the Memorandum of Agreement for the sustainability of school feeding in Haiti between the Government of Haiti and the World Food Programme (WFP) https://www.haitilibre.com/en/news-7406-haiti-social-towards-a-true-system-of-school-canteens.html

The Technical Secretariat of UNASUR in Haiti, intends to deliver the money to the recipients through WFP, as it had previously done in its first intervention. The implementing rules will be determined by the Government of Haiti, the Technical Secretariat of UNASUR and WFP, in accordance with the experience collected during the previous operation performed in the same region.
